对象存储相关概念是什么意思,深入解析对象存储相关概念,技术原理与应用场景
- 综合资讯
- 2024-12-19 00:42:19
- 2

对象存储相关概念是指一种基于对象的存储技术,它将数据存储为对象,每个对象包含数据本体、元数据以及一个唯一标识符。技术原理包括使用HTTP协议进行数据传输,并通过对象键值...
对象存储相关概念是指一种基于对象的存储技术,它将数据存储为对象,每个对象包含数据本体、元数据以及一个唯一标识符。技术原理包括使用HTTP协议进行数据传输,并通过对象键值对进行数据检索。应用场景涵盖云存储、大数据处理、内容分发等领域,广泛应用于网站图片、视频、文件等非结构化数据的存储和管理。
随着互联网和大数据技术的快速发展,数据存储需求日益增长,对象存储作为一种新型的数据存储技术,凭借其独特的优势,逐渐成为大数据、云计算等领域的主流存储方式,本文将深入解析对象存储相关概念,包括技术原理、应用场景、优势与挑战等。
对象存储的概念
对象存储是一种基于对象的存储方式,将数据以对象的形式进行存储和管理,对象存储系统由对象、容器、元数据、访问控制、存储节点等组成,对象是存储的基本单元,通常包括数据、元数据和唯一标识符。
1、对象:对象是存储的基本单元,由数据、元数据和唯一标识符组成,数据是存储的实际内容,可以是文件、图片、视频等;元数据描述对象的基本属性,如创建时间、大小、类型等;唯一标识符用于区分不同的对象。
2、容器:容器是对象的集合,用于组织和管理对象,容器可以包含多个对象,并且可以对其进行增删改查等操作。
3、元数据:元数据描述对象的属性,如创建时间、大小、类型等,元数据可以帮助用户快速检索和管理对象。
4、访问控制:访问控制用于确保对象存储系统的安全性,包括用户认证、权限控制等。
5、存储节点:存储节点是对象存储系统的组成部分,负责存储和管理对象,存储节点可以是物理服务器,也可以是虚拟机。
对象存储的技术原理
1、分布式存储:对象存储采用分布式存储架构,将数据分散存储在多个存储节点上,提高数据存储的可靠性和性能。
2、数据分片:对象存储将数据按照一定规则进行分片,将大文件分割成多个小文件进行存储,提高数据存储的效率。
3、数据复制:为了提高数据可靠性,对象存储系统会对数据进行复制,将数据备份到多个存储节点上。
4、数据压缩:对象存储系统对数据进行压缩,减少数据存储空间,提高存储效率。
5、数据加密:为了确保数据安全性,对象存储系统对数据进行加密,防止数据泄露。
对象存储的应用场景
1、云计算:对象存储是云计算基础设施的重要组成部分,为云计算应用提供数据存储服务。
2、大数据:对象存储适用于大规模数据存储,如日志、监控数据等。
3、物联网:对象存储可以存储海量物联网设备产生的数据,如传感器数据、视频监控数据等。
4、文件存储:对象存储可以替代传统的文件存储系统,提高文件存储的效率和可靠性。
分发网络(CDN):对象存储可以用于CDN的缓存存储,提高内容分发速度。
对象存储的优势与挑战
1、优势:
(1)高可靠性:分布式存储架构和数据复制技术提高数据可靠性。
(2)高性能:数据分片和负载均衡技术提高数据访问性能。
(3)高扩展性:分布式存储架构和存储节点可扩展性满足大规模数据存储需求。
(4)低成本:对象存储系统采用通用硬件,降低存储成本。
2、挑战:
(1)数据一致性:分布式存储架构下,保证数据一致性是一个挑战。
(2)数据迁移:在现有存储系统向对象存储系统迁移过程中,需要考虑数据迁移的效率和安全性。
(3)数据安全:对象存储系统需要确保数据安全,防止数据泄露和恶意攻击。
对象存储作为一种新型的数据存储技术,凭借其独特的优势,在云计算、大数据、物联网等领域得到广泛应用,了解对象存储相关概念,有助于更好地应用对象存储技术,为企业提供高效、可靠、安全的存储服务。
本文链接:https://zhitaoyun.cn/1653652.html
发表评论